Message-ID: <1991Jun16.014827.1484@spcvxb.spc.edu> Date: 16 Jun 91 01:48:27 GMT References: <80107@eerie.acsu.Buffalo.EDU> Organization: St. Peter's College, US Lines: 14 In article <80107@eerie.acsu.Buffalo.EDU>, kalisiak@acsu.buffalo.edu (christophe m kalisiak) writes: > Now for the question. I have an NEC 2246 8" SMD drive which I would like > to attach to the system. I have been informed that I should not try an > SC03-BX (due to the RH11 not being supported), but should get either an > SC03-MS or QD32. I will go with a QD32 if I have to, but I would like to > know if I would somehow be able to use an SC03-MS. The QD32 is a _much_ nicer board than the SC03. Dual-width, much lower power requirements, faster, etc. I have 2 of 'em in use here and they've been very reliable.
